LONDON (Reuters) – The proportion of Russians who belief President Vladimir Putin has risen to 81.6% from 67.2% earlier than he ordered troops into Ukraine on Feb. 24, in keeping with a survey by the state-run pollster VTsIOM revealed on Friday.
The battle has displaced greater than 10 million Ukrainians from their properties, killed or injured hundreds, turned cities into rubble and led to sweeping Western sanctions that can push down Russian dwelling requirements.
VTsIOM mentioned 78.9% of respondents in its newest survey mentioned they permitted of Putin’s actions, in comparison with 64.3% within the final ballot earlier than the beginning of what Russia calls its “particular navy operation”. The proportion who disapproved of his actions fell to 12.9% from 24.4%.
Ukraine and Western leaders have condemned Russia’s navy marketing campaign as unprovoked aggression. The Kremlin says it needed to demilitarise and “denazify” Ukraine to guard Russian-speakers and pre-empt a menace from the Western NATO alliance.
VTsIOM’s numbers had been much like these in a survey revealed on March 30 by the impartial Levada Middle, by which the proportion of Russians saying they permitted of Putin’s actions rose to 83% from 71% in February.
Levada recorded a comparable surge in Putin’s approval score in 2014, when Russia seized Crimea from Ukraine and annexed it and Russian-speaking separatists took management of a part of the Donbas area of jap Ukraine with Moscow’s help.
Bizarre Russians have little entry to impartial reporting on their nation as virtually all vital media retailers that diverge from authorities coverage have been closed down in the previous couple of years.
Since Feb. 24, Moscow has additional restricted entry to overseas media and social media, and made it a felony offence to publish studies concerning the armed forces that deviate from official statements.
VTsIOM mentioned it surveys 1,600 individuals throughout Russia every day and its weekly polls are a mean of responses from the earlier seven days.
The ballot revealed on Friday was gathered between March 28 and April 4, it mentioned.
